What are the raw materials and products of photosynthesis?

WebThe raw materials for photosynthesis are as follows: Carbon dioxide – through gaseous exchange carried out by stomata. Water – roots absorb water from the soil provided by irrigation or even rains. Sunlight – chlorophyll , the green pigment present in green plants traps solar energy. WebOct 20, 2024 · The plants get the following raw materials required for photosynthesis as: 1)Carbon dioxide (CO2 ) enters from the atmosphere through the stomatal pore. 2)Sunlight is absorbed by the chlorophyll and other green parts of the plant. 3)Water is absorbed from the soil by the roots of the plant.
